ProgrammeOur vision is to prepare students for European leadership roles in the private and public sector. We have designed the programme to provide a comprehensive and up-to-date study of economic and political dynamics in Europe.Studies in European private and public management, in European economics, law and politics, an intensive seminar in Brussels plus a period of practical training offer an ideal combination of theoretical knowledge, management education, practical skills and European expertise. Our unique blend of academic expertise and application-oriented classes make this an exceptional experience. The faculty is composed of international and national university lecturers and EU practitioners. Emphasis is laid on an interdisciplinary approach in teaching and learning, group work, discussions and a lively exchange between participants. Due to the international set-up of the program, students will be confronted with the need to cope with the cultural and individual differences that arise in a multicultural setting, familiarising them with working across cultures and working in international teams. Target audienceThe program is open to postgraduates with an academic degree in Public Policy/ or Management, Economics or Business, Political Sciences or Law or a comparable academic background.It is designed to provide interdisciplinary education and training for tomorrow’s managers of European affairs. Students come from different backgrounds and will benefit from opportunities to develop a European perspective and to broaden their knowledge and skills in significant aspects of European management. Due to the demanding time frame high academic standards and a very diligent work schedule are required. |

Emphases/CurriculumThe main objective of the program is to convey a sound a specialist knowledge of European public and private management. The course consists of 10 modules providing students with an interdisciplinary approach to key factors of European integration.The modules will be divided between lectures and seminars. Lectures provide a throrough grounding in the essentials of European business and management, policies and law. In the seminars, students will develop specialist knowledge in a variety of fields. Practical relevanceExcursionsThe Intensive Seminar in Brussels and an ongoing programme called "Meet the Europeans" provide ample opportunity to get in close contact with representatives from EU-administrations, European-based organizations and enterprises, to take part in cultural activities and to visit EU-sponsored projects in the region. It is a truly international program with students coming from all over the world, including India, China, Vietnam, Latvia, Germany, Korea, France, Belgium, Ireland, Norway, Chile, Japan and many more. |

OrganisationCurrently, Hochschule Bremen has approx. 8500 students from more than 100 countries in more than 50 degree programmes, covering the areas of business, engineering, science, economics, social science and the humanities.Depending on the course, degree-seeking students are awarded the traditional German academic degree (‘Diplom’) or a bachelor’s or master’s degree. Hochschule Bremen is well know for its international approach, with 258 university partnership programmes world-wide, as well for its close co-operation between the University and regional industry. UAS Bremen is accredited as a national higher education institution and has received numerous awards, including one named Best-Practice University in 2000 by the CHE, the Centre for University Development; it was honoured by the Association of Sponsors of German Arts and Science for its instituted reforms, won the Marketing Prize "Highlight 2001" from the Marketing-Club Bremen and the DAAD-Prize for International University Marketing in 2000. |
